Ingredients:

  • 1 pound bo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into 1-inch cubes
  • Bamboo skewers (soaked in water for at least 30 minutes to prevent burning)
  • 1/4 cup butter
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/2 cup honey
  • 1/4 cup apple cider vinegar
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ar
  • 2 tablespoons cornstarch
  • 1/4 cup water
  • Cooking Instructions:

    Preparing the Chicken and Skewers

    The first step to perfectly grilled skewers is proper preparation. We’ll start by ensuring our bamboo skewers are ready to go. It’s crucial to soak your bamboo skewers in water for at least 30 minutes before you plan to use them. This simple step prevents them from catching fire on the hot grill, which can be a messy and sometimes even dangerous mishap. While the skewers are soaking, it’s time to prepare the chicken. Take your boneless, skinless chicken breasts and cut them into uniform 1-inch cubes. Uniformity is key here, as it ensures that each piece of chicken cooks evenly. If some pieces are significantly larger than others, you’ll end up with a mix of overcooked and undercooked chicken, and nobody wants that. You can trim any excess fat from the chicken before cubing.

    Crafting the Irresistible Honey Garlic Sauce

    Now for the magical part – the honey garlic sauce! This sauce is incredibly easy to whip up and delivers a punch of flavor that perfectly complements the grilled chicken. In a medium sa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Once the butter is melted and slightly shimmering, add the minced garlic. Sauté the garlic for about 1 minute, until it’s fragrant but not browned. Burnt garlic can turn bitter, so keep a close eye on it. To this fragrant garlic butter, add the honey, apple cider vinegar, soy sauce, and brown sugar. Stir everything together until the brown sugar has dissolved. Bring the mixture to a simmer and let it cook for about 2-3 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ld together. In a small bowl, whisk together the cornstarch and water until smooth. This is our thickening agent. Slowly pour the cornstarch slurry into the simmering sauce while continuously whisking. Continue to cook and whisk for another 1-2 minutes, or until the sauce has thickened to a nice, glossy consistency. It should coat the back of a spoon. Remove the sauce from the heat and set it aside. You’ll be using a good portion of this to glaze the chicken as it cooks.

    Assembling the Skewers

    Once your chicken is cubed and your skewers have soaked sufficiently, it’s time to thread them. Take your soaked bamboo skewers and carefully thread the chicken cubes onto them. Don’t overcrowd the skewers; leave a small space between each piece of chicken. This allows for even cooking and better caramelization of the glaze. Aim for about 3-4 chicken pieces per skewer, depending on the length of your skewers and the size of your cubes. Having a little space also makes it easier to turn them on the grill. If you have any leftover chicken pieces that don’t fit perfectly onto a skewer, you can always grill them loose.

    Grilling to Perfection

    Preheat your grill to medium-high heat. A well-preheated grill is essential for achieving those beautiful grill marks and preventing the chicken from sticking. Once the grill is hot, carefully place the assembled chicken skewers onto the grates. Grill the skewers for about 4-6 minutes per side, or until the chicken is cooked through and has developed nice char marks. During the grilling process, this is where the magic of the sauce really shines. Brush the chicken skewers generously with the honey garlic sauce during the last few minutes of grilling. You’ll want to flip them and brush the other side as well. The sugars in the sauce will caramelize beautifully, creating a sticky, flavorful coating. Be careful not to burn the glaze, as the sugars can ignite. If you see any flare-ups, move the skewers to a cooler part of the grill temporarily.

    Resting and Serving

    Once the chicken is cooked through and beautifully glazed, remove the skewers from the grill. It’s important to let the chicken rest for a few minutes before serving. This allows the juices to redistribute throughout the meat, resulting in more tender and flavorful chicken. Tent the skewers loosely with foil for about 5 minutes. While the chicken is resting, you can warm up any remaining honey garlic sauce if you wish, or simply serve it on the side for dipping. These Easy Grilled Asian Chicken Skewers are fantastic served with steamed rice, a crisp side salad, or grilled vegetables.     Frequently Asked Questions:

    Can I marinate the chicken longer than recommended?

    Absolutely! Marinating for a few hours, or even overnight in the refrigerator, will allow the flavors to penetrate the chicken even more deeply, resulting in an even more delicious and tender skewer. Just ensure it’s covered tightly.

    What can I do if I don’t have a grill?

    No worries! You can easily achieve similar results by pan-searing the marinated chicken pieces in a hot, oiled skillet until cooked through and nicely browned. Alternatively, you can bake them on a baking sheet at around 400°F (200°C) until cooked through, basting with the sauce during the last few minutes of baking.

    How do I prevent the honey garlic sauce from burning on the grill?

    The sugar in the honey can cause it to burn quickly. To avoid this, I recommend basting the skewers with the honey garlic sauce during the last few minutes of grilling. This will allow the sauce to caramelize beautifully without burning to a crisp.
